Teaching children to read analog clocks and perform addition and subtraction is essential for their cognitive development and real-life skills. For ages 5-8, mastering these concepts lays a foundation for logical thinking and problem-solving abilities.
Understanding how to read an analog clock equips children with the ability to tell time without relying on digital devices, fostering independence. This skill also enhances their spatial awareness, as they learn to interpret positions and movements of the clock hands, thereby improving their overall math skills.
Simultaneously, addition and subtraction are fundamental arithmetic operations that underpin more complex mathematical concepts. Engaging children in these skills through practical activities, such as setting a clock for specific times or calculating durations, enhances their ability to perform mental math and increases their confidence in number sense.
Moreover, integrating these lessons with daily routines – like asking them to determine when it's time to leave for school based on clock reading or counting down from a certain time – makes learning meaningful and relevant.
